description This research aims to explore the practice of technology roadmapping (TRM) in Malaysia. Managers from a total of 11 firms were interviewed and follow by an in-depth study in a firm. The interviews have revealed that the use of TRM in Malaysia is limited. These findings signal a strong ignorance of the dramatic impact technologies have on organizations among businesses operating in Malaysia. The findings from an in-depth interview showed that TRM has been effectively implemented by a firm. It also has enabled many technology roadmaps to be developed for identifying new technological research areas in future.
